Said to be the largest collection of Spitfires under one roof, the 12 airframes chronicle the evolution of the Spitfire from the Mk.1 up to a Mk.22 that’s just a little bit in-complete. JG891 is about the only Spitfire you can’t get a decent photo of as it’s stuck in a corner. The exhibition runs from the 27th December to the 20th February 2022. All photos are hand held and for the photographers, the lighting conditions are a bit iffy as there are two types of ceiling lights, clear and orange and only half the space is lit.
